Medical Coder Job Vacancy in Ruwais, United Arab Emirates
JOB DESCRIPTION
- The incumbent checks and sequences the most accurate ICD-9/ ICD10- CM/CPT/HCPCS/DRG/Other codes for diagnoses and procedures for documented information. Assures the final diagnoses and operative procedures as stated by the physician are valid and complete.
- Abstracts all necessary information from health records to identify secondary complications and co-morbid conditions.
- Evaluates the record for documentation consistency and adequacy. Ensures that the final diagnosis accurately reflects the care and treatment rendered. Computes and gives the correct DRG coding all inpatients cases.
- Providing training and guiding other coders / Medical Records Technicians in coding, updating them with new coding rules and regulations as and when it is necessary.
- Analyzes doctors’ documentation to assure the appropriate Evaluation and Management (E&M) levels are assigned using the correct CPT code.
- Ensures coding is as per DOH guidelines and regulations.
- Provides feedback to Doctors regarding coding errors or oversights.
- Constantly updates to the latest coding versions and DOH coding directives.
- Performs miscellaneous job-related duties as assigned.
- Performs any other jobs or duties assigned by the HOD from time to time within the scope of job title.
- Verify the items in the open bills according to TPA/payer, member ID, validity of the card, coverage, approvals/LPO, insurance plan, rate plan etc. Ensure that the bills are finalized in compliance with the contractual terms and price agreement.
- Finalize all codified credit bills for batch/statement generation based on the submission cycle (eg, weekly, monthly etc). In the case of pharmacy claims, check the transactions according to TPA/payer, member ID, validity of the card, coverage, approvals/LPO, insurance plan, refunded transactions etc and confirm the bill.

QUALIFICATIONS
- A graduate of Bachelor’s Degree in Allied Health Sciences or related areas with at least two (2) years of coding experience with valid Certified Coding Associate (CCA) certification from American Health Information Management Association (AHIMA) or Certified Professional Coder (CPC) certification from American Academy of Professional Coders (AAPC).
- Computer Literacy, MS Office.
- Excellent command of oral and written English.
